    3. Once again the genealogists have risen in support of one of their own. I can imagine that Beverley's work has saved many people a lot of time and expense with their research. How much simpler it might have been if she had obtained permission from the library when she planned this project. With a library book you are entitled to photocopy a few pages or at most 10% legally without falling foul of copyright laws. When an individual researches in the library and copies an individual or families records it is presumed to be for their own use. No infringement. However, wholesale copying appears to be another kettle of fish and there is always the likelihood of being accused of breaching copyright.
